Safety and Security of WordPress Blog (Infographic)

WordPress is one of the most popular content management system (CMS) in use and around 17% of the websites that are present on the internet these days are powered by this CMS. With the growing use of WordPress its security and safety has also become one of the major issues to deal with. In the year 2011 more than 144,000 word press sites were hacked and this number reached to 170,000 in the year 2012.

The website owners and the core developers of WordPress are responsible for the security of the system. In order to keep their security tight, the WordPress site owners should keep various points into consideration like updating the WordPress to the latest version that is released, keeping back of data, do not display the version of WordPress on blog, reporting bugs to WordPress security, not installing the free themes, using strong passwords for all the entry points, using only trusted plug-in and others.

Some of the most common ways that result in the site being hacked are having virus on the computer, keeping easy to crack password, approving comments that are non relevant, Contact US form going to the script in the site for processing and website displaying only the plain HTML+ JavaScript pages. Thus one should take care of these points to avoid getting their site hacked.

wordpress

 

Advertisements

How to Create Website in few minutes

Step -1

Choose a website building platform

Building a fully working and eye-catchy website isn’t that difficult – even for a beginner who isn’t very computer savvy. But things can go extremely wrong when you don’t choose the right website building platform. A lot of people think that creating a website from scratch is difficult and requires high level of coding and design skills, but that’s not true.

Before I help you to choose the right platform for your website, I want you to let you know that there are tons of different ways to build a website. Back in 2004, most of the sites were built with HTML, CSS or even FLASH.

In 2015, things have changed a lot to say the least. CMS (Content Management Systems) have started to dominate the whole web development industry. See the graph below.

popular-website-platforms

As you can see, nearly half of the websites on the internet are running on WordPress website platform. The reason is quite simple, actually:

  1. No need to know HTML or any other web coding languages.
  2. WordPress itself is FREE and it has tons of different free themes/layouts to choose from.
  3. You can create access to multiple users who can publish content to your website.
  4. You can add content, images and videos just by logging into your WordPress dashboard.
  5. Your website will look professional, it’ll work on mobiles and tablets as well.

My own site, the one that you are currently browsing is also built with WordPress. As an alternative, you can check out other similar website platforms, such as Drupal and Joomla. I’ve even made a prettycomprehensive comparison between WordPress, Joomla and Drupal. If for some reason you don’t want to build your site with WordPress, check out my Drupal, Joomla and HTML5 guides as well. They are all FREE to use.

But for a beginner, I’m suggesting to stick with WordPress. If you wish to know more how popular WordPress is, have a look at this article: 14 facts about WordPress.

What about all the websites that offer free website creation?

You must have heard about Weebly, Wix and other similar sites where you need to register, enter your personal details and once that’s done you’ll be able to create a free website.

At first it might sound like a really sweet deal, but actually there are three big “no-no”‘s

  1. You don’t have a control over your website – Your site will be hosted on another website, and thus it makes them literally own your website. I know it might sound confusing, but in short – you just don’t have control. If they think that your site is violating their TOS – they can easily delete it with no warnings. Do you want your website (or business) rely on that? Probably no.
  2. Poor design and limited functionality – Your site will look more or less blank or similar to the other websites on the web. They have limited themes and templates to choose from which makes your site a bit boring for the visitor. On the other hand, WordPress has over 1500 different themes and layouts to choose from.
  3. You need to pay if you want to move further – If you want to get your own domain name (YourWebsite.com) or you want to get more disk space/bandwidth – you need to pay. That’s the main reason why I suggest you to host your website by yourself by choosing a reputable hosting company.

Of course, if you want – you can try them out. But I’m sure you can make a way more better website with CMS (WordPress) – and you’ll keep the control over your web property.

I’m not very computer savvy, can I still do it with WordPress?

I get emails everyday where people all hesitating whether to give it a try and create a website by themselves or just hire someone.

My answer is always the same: Try it.

This guide is mainly for people who are interested in making a professional-looking website with minimal costs and without any previous knowledge. In most cases, it’s a smart choice to make a website yourself rather than spending thousands of dollars on web designers and developers who will use WordPress (in most cases) anyway.

Recently, this guide has helped a lot of new start-ups, small business owners, creative persons (writers, artists, photographers), freelancers and bloggers (with WordPress you are able to set up a blog as well).

P.S: I’m currently offering free help via email, so if you get stuck during set up process or need any other help, just use the contact form.

If you are ready, let’s go to the step 2 where I teach you how to find a domain name and hosting. In step 3 I’ll explain you how to install and customize your WordPress website. At this point, you don’t have to install or set up anything, this will all be covered in next steps – keep reading.

Step-2

Finding a web host and a domain name

Before I move on and give you the step-by-step instructions for setting up a web page with WordPress, I have to let you know that it will cost you some money. WordPress itself is FREE, but a personal domain name (YourSiteName.com) and hosting (service that connects your site to the internet) will cost you approximately $3-$4 per month. If you don’t get hosting nor domain name, your site address will look unprofessional. Some examples:YourBusiness.FreeWebsites.com or YourWebsite.FreeSitePlatform.com

I’ve mostly used godaddy for domain name and hosting registrar, so it’s worth checking them out.

In short, if you want to set up a website for others to read/browse – you’ll need both of them (domain and hosting). When you buy a hosting and a domain name, you’ll also get a personal email account(s): you@yoursite.com – Cool, right?

If you already have a domain and hosting, feel free to skip this step and move onto Step 2, where I’ll going to explain you how to set up a website.

If you DON’T HAVE HOSTING/DOMAIN, see my instructions and suggestions below:

One of the hardest things is coming up with a decent domain name. Here are few tips that could help you in the long run:

  1. If you are planning to create a website for your business then simply use the company name as a domain. For example: YourCompanyName.com
  2. If you are planning to set up a website for yourself, then YourName.com can be a suitable option as well.
  3. If you are having trouble finding the best possible domain name for your website I suggest you follow these three simple guidelines:
  • Is it brandable? For example, if you make a site about poetry then best-poetry-website.net is not a good choice: poetryacademy.com or poetryfall.com are much more better.
  • Is it memorable? People tend to like short, understandable domain names. If your domain name is too fuzzy and long then when they want to return they will have already forgotten it.
  • Is it catchy? Coming up with a catchy, cool name is pretty difficult since there are approximately 150 million active domain names in the world right now.

However, there’s one rule that always applies to domain names: If you like it, go for it.

Hosting & Domain – Where should YOU get it?

As I mentioned above, in addition to a domain you will also need hosting. There are literally hundreds of different hosting companies who are all available to host your site.

However, in the past 4-5 years while I have been setting up and managing different websites and blogs I have discovered there are only a few real and legitimate hosting companies that actually deliver. You can usually get your domain name and hosting together from those hosting companies.

I’m currently using to host all my websites and thus I’m recommending them. Here’s why I think they are the best in the industry:

  • Their hosting package is one of the cheapest – less than $2 per month with a FREE domain name included.
  • They have been in the hosting business since 2002.
  • They have “one-click-install” for WordPress, Drupal and Joomla platforms. (You don’t need to set up your site manually.)
  • Their average up-time is 99,9% (Reliable).

However, feel free to use any other hosting company as long as it’s reliable and secure. Make sure you double-check the background before buying anything.

 

Step-3

 

Setting up your WordPress website

First, you need to install WordPress to your domain. Almost all reliable and well-established hosting companies have integrated 1-click-installation for WordPress. Simply browse around on your hosting cPanel until you find the way to install WordPress. I’ve listed two possible ways to install WordPress to your domain.

Install WordPress with “One-Click-Installation”

If you any other similar hosting company, you should find your WordPress “one-click-installation” in your account control panel. Here are the steps you should follow:

  1. Log in to your hosting account.
  2. Go to your control panel.
  3. Look for the “WordPress” icon.
  4. Choose the domain where you want to install your website.
  5. Click the “Install Now” button and you should get access to your NEW WordPress website.

If you don’t have the possibility to install WordPress automatically, look this manual guide below:

Choose the right theme/layout for your website

Once you have successfully installed WordPress to your domain, you’ll see a very basic yet clean site:

basicwordpress

1) Log into your WordPress dashboard to change themes and start building and tweaking your site – you can log in from http://yoursite.com/wp-admin

This is your WordPress dashboard:

WordPress_dashboard

Looks pretty awesome, doesn’t it?

2) Now you need to start looking for a proper theme – make sure it fits with the overall topic of your new website. You can find over 1500 free themes via the WordPress Dashboard (Appearance -> Themes). If you want something more professional or elegant, head over toThemeForest.net

However, at first I suggest you to try the free themes because some of them are actually really professional and well made.

Changing-theme

As you can see above, installing a new theme (outlook) for your website is very easy. All you need to do is search for specific keywords and/or use filters.

Once you have found a theme you like, click “Install” followed by “Activate”:

installing_website_theme

 

Finding the perfect theme can take a while, but it’s worth it. If you don’t find anything good right away, you can always return and search further later on. Changing themes won’t delete your previous posts, pages and content. In other words, you can change it as often as you want.

P.S: If you want a theme that works well on mobile phones, search for the keyword “responsive”.

Add content and create new pages

Once you have installed a theme you like, you can start creating content. Adding new pages in WordPress is again very easy, but I’ll cover the basics for you.

Pages: In order to create new pages such as “About Me”, “Resources” etc (like I have on the menu), you need to head over to the WordPress dashboard and look for “Pages” -> “Add New”.

If you want those pages to appear on the menu as well, you need to go to “Appearance -> Menus” and add them to the list.

 

website-menu

Posts: If you want to add a blog to your website, you can use different categories and posts. Let’s say you want to create a category named “blog”. To do so, simply add it to your menu and start making posts. Here’s what you need to do:

 

blogcategory

a) Create a new category by going to “Posts -> Categories”

b) Create a blog post by going to “Posts -> Add New”. Once you blog post is ready, you need to add the right category for it.

c) Add a new category to the menu

Tweak your website (Widgets, comments & just some “stuff” you need to know)

In this section I’ll cover some of the basics things that will help you to tweak your website.

Changing website title and tagline: You probably noticed, that my website has a title: “How to Make a Website” and a tagline: “… Step by Step tutorial“.

In order to change the title and tagline on your website, go to “Settings -> General” and simply fill in the form.

site_title_tagline

Disabling comments for Posts & Pages: Some websites (business/organisation sites mostly) don’t need any comments from visitors.

While you are writing a new page, click “Screen Options” (top right) and then tick “Discussion”. The “Allow Comments” box will appear at the bottom and all you need to do is untick “Allow Comments”.

In case you want to turn off comments on every new page by default, go to “Settings -> Discussion” and untick those options:

webcomments

Static front-page: If you want your site to have a static front page, go to “Settings -> Reading” and pick a static page for your website. If you don’t do this, WordPress will take your latest posts and start showing them on your homepage.

Editing the sidebar: Most WordPress themes have a sidebar on the right side (in some cases it’s on the left). By default you’ll see something like this:

If you want to delete the categories, meta and archives (which are pointless in most cases) go to “Appearance -> Widgets”. From there you can use drag n’ drop to add different “boxes” to your sidebar.

There’s also a “HTML box” which is basically a text box where you can use HTML code.

Install plugins to get the most out of your website

WordPress gives you the opportunity to install different plugins that all add value and make your website more “personal” and unique.

To start installing plugins, go to “Plugins -> Add New” and simply start searching. Keep in mind that there are over 25,000 different FREE plugins.

… but before you go and install every single one, I suggest you to read this article: Things you need to know about using WP plugins. Below, I have put together a list of the most popular and useful plugins that webmasters find useful:

Contact form 7: My website has a contact form on my About Mepage. It’s great, as people can simply fill in the form and send me an email without logging into their email provider. If you want the same, install Contact Form 7.

Facebook box: A lot of websites have Facebook plugins on their sidebar. A Facebook Box helps you drive more traffic and likes to your Facebook fanpage (if you have one).

Forum: Interested in starting a forum on your site? Look for the plugin named “bbPress” and follow their tutorials.

Actually there are many more plugins available. Here’s a list of thetop 100 plugins for WordPress by Tom Ewer.

… and that is basically it. Now you should have a fully working WordPress website! If you need some further help, please use the contact form at the footer area.

Congratulations!!